In a general sence yes, in some places fortunatly they are still common but those are exceptions to the rule, in most places they have at least declined and in some they are close to total extirpation, no wonder considering the numbers captured for chinese food markets. And the situation can get WAY worse fast, Cuora amboinensis is not a very slow breeder but its not a fast breeding turtle either. Considering the demand they can easily enter a situation of completly unsustainable overexploting in all of its range, wich in a medium term cenario could mean that this species would join the group of the critically endangered ones.futureless;4523350; said:is it endangered? because i'm in indonesia and coura ambonensis can be found easily here
